5th ranked Barton men's soccer sweeps Week 10 KJCCC Player of the Week Honors #GoBarton

Barton Men's Soccer Wk 10 Players of the Week

For the fourth time this season, the 5th ranked Barton Community College men's soccer team swept the Jayhawk Conference Division I Player of the Week awards, with sophomore striker Lucas Constante and goalkeeper Dennis Bottcher rewarded for their week 10 performances.

The duo helped the Cougars to a perfect week, picking up a key 2-1 victory at 10th ranked Cowley College before closing the week helping secure the program's 12th Jayhawk Conference title in a 7-0 route over Garden City Community College.

Securing his second conference honor of the season, Constante accumulated a seven-point week furnishing a trio of goals and dishing out an assist. The sophomore striker, opened his week netting both goals in Barton's 2-1 win at 10th ranked Cowley, in helping the Cougars to their first season sweep over the Tigers.

Constante concluded his week shaking the nets with his conference leading 12th goal while also assisting on one of Barton's other six goals in the conference clinching victory over the Broncbusters.

Grasping his fourth distinction of the year, Bottcher recorded the two victories in net denying six of his seven shots faced to improve to 11-1-3 on the year. The sophomore started his strong week sending back two denials in the 2-1 victory at 10th ranked Cowley.

The sophomore keeper finished his week assisting the Cougars to their fifth shutout of the season making all four saves in his 54-minutes of action in net.

The top seeded Cougars, now 15-1-3 on the season, enter post-season play on Friday hosting a first-round Plains District playoff game at 1:00 p.m. versus sixth seeded Coffeyville Community College (3-7-2, 7-7-4). If the Cougars win, Barton will additionally host a semifinal match on Wednesday, November 1st.
